<?xml version='1.0' encoding='UTF-8'?><?xml-stylesheet href="http://www.blogger.com/styles/atom.css" type="text/css"?><feed xmlns='http://www.w3.org/2005/Atom' xmlns:openSearch='http://a9.com/-/spec/opensearchrss/1.0/' xmlns:georss='http://www.georss.org/georss' xmlns:gd='http://schemas.google.com/g/2005' xmlns:thr='http://purl.org/syndication/thread/1.0'><id>tag:blogger.com,1999:blog-19717775</id><updated>2011-04-21T12:44:10.284-07:00</updated><title type='text'>Manh-Kiet Yap : SOA &amp; IdM Blogs</title><subtitle type='html'>All about Service Oriented Architecture, Security and Identity Management stuff !!!</subtitle><link rel='http://schemas.google.com/g/2005#feed' type='application/atom+xml' href='http://mkyap.blogspot.com/feeds/posts/default'/><link rel='self' type='application/atom+xml' href='http://www.blogger.com/feeds/19717775/posts/default?max-results=100'/><link rel='alternate' type='text/html' href='http://mkyap.blogspot.com/'/><link rel='hub' href='http://pubsubhubbub.appspot.com/'/><author><name>Manh-Kiet Yap</name><uri>http://www.blogger.com/profile/06593472507265724096</uri><email>noreply@blogger.com</email><gd:image rel='http://schemas.google.com/g/2005#thumbnail' width='24' height='32' src='http://photos1.blogger.com/hello/117/9006/320/ky_portrait.jpg'/></author><generator version='7.00' uri='http://www.blogger.com'>Blogger</generator><openSearch:totalResults>2</openSearch:totalResults><openSearch:startIndex>1</openSearch:startIndex><openSearch:itemsPerPage>100</openSearch:itemsPerPage><entry><id>tag:blogger.com,1999:blog-19717775.post-113425724642295282</id><published>2005-12-10T15:19:00.000-08:00</published><updated>2006-01-10T06:23:56.993-08:00</updated><title type='text'>Designing and Developing SOA based application</title><content type='html'>&lt;strong&gt;&lt;span style="font-size:85%;"&gt;&lt;em&gt;Let's start at the beginning : What is SOA ?&lt;br /&gt;&lt;/em&gt;&lt;/span&gt;&lt;br /&gt;&lt;/strong&gt;&lt;span style="font-size:85%;"&gt;The question may sound stupid, but try to answer by yourself to this question, and then ask it around your friends and colleagues : I'm pretty sure that you will not get a formal and unique response to it ... unless they are Dutch (*) ... ;)&lt;/span&gt;&lt;br /&gt;&lt;a href="http://photos1.blogger.com/blogger/5331/1715/1600/soa-arch.3.jpg"&gt;&lt;/a&gt;&lt;br /&gt;&lt;a href="http://photos1.blogger.com/blogger/5331/1715/1600/soa-arch.1.jpg"&gt;&lt;/a&gt;&lt;span style="font-size:85%;"&gt;From a very high level, we can summarize SOA as an application design architecture which allows to move away from a monolithic/silo-based application model, to a services oriented, highly reuseable, implementation regardless and loosely-coupled based composite-application model. &lt;/span&gt;&lt;br /&gt;&lt;br /&gt;&lt;br /&gt;&lt;span style="font-size:85%;"&gt;&lt;/span&gt;&lt;img style="margin: 0px auto 10px; display: block; text-align: center;" alt="" src="http://photos1.blogger.com/blogger/5331/1715/400/soa-arch.3.jpg" border="0" /&gt;&lt;br /&gt;&lt;span style="font-size:85%;"&gt;In theory, this sounds idyllic. But if we drill-down a bit further we realized that a lot of areas still need clarification. For example : &lt;em&gt;How to create those "services" ?&lt;/em&gt; &lt;em&gt;Should I have to write them again or is there any technique to "wrap" existing modules from my legacy applications to "services" ?&lt;/em&gt; &lt;em&gt;How to link and orchestrate those services together ? How to secure efficiently the communication between services ?&lt;/em&gt; &lt;/span&gt;&lt;br /&gt;&lt;span style="font-size:85%;"&gt;&lt;/span&gt;&lt;br /&gt;&lt;span style="font-size:85%;"&gt;&lt;em&gt;&lt;strong&gt;Introducing Service Component Architecture (SCA) and Service Data Objects (SDO) &lt;/strong&gt;&lt;/em&gt;&lt;/span&gt;&lt;br /&gt;&lt;br /&gt;&lt;span style="font-size:85%;"&gt;&lt;/span&gt;&lt;p align="left"&gt;&lt;span style="font-size:85%;"&gt;Recently, Oracle and other major SOA vendors have released &lt;/span&gt;&lt;span style="font-size:100%;"&gt;2 &lt;/span&gt;&lt;span style="font-size:85%;"&gt;new specifications, Service Component Architecture (SCA) and Service Data Objects (SDO), which aim to :&lt;/span&gt;&lt;/p&gt;&lt;ul&gt;&lt;li&gt;&lt;span style="font-size:85%;"&gt;Help developers and architects to build SOA based system in the common way, by reducing the design and development complexity, as well as eliminating dependencies to the middleware where those component are executed.&lt;/span&gt;&lt;/li&gt;&lt;li&gt;&lt;span style="font-size:85%;"&gt;A standard way to represent business data to developers and architects, regardless on how they are physicall accessed.&lt;/span&gt;&lt;/li&gt;&lt;/ul&gt;&lt;p&gt;&lt;span style="font-size:85%;"&gt;More information can be found at the &lt;a href="http://www.oracle.com/technology/tech/webservices/index.html"&gt;Oracle Service-Oriented Architecture Technology Center &lt;/a&gt;&lt;/span&gt;&lt;span style="font-size:85%;"&gt;within the Oracle Technology Network website (&lt;a href="http://otn.oracle.com"&gt;http://otn.oracle.com&lt;/a&gt;). &lt;/span&gt;&lt;/p&gt;&lt;p&gt;&lt;span style="font-size:85%;"&gt;In the future, I'll drill down into a specific area about securing and managing web services : Policy Driven Approach to secure SOA environment. So stay tune !&lt;/span&gt;&lt;/p&gt;&lt;p&gt;&lt;em&gt;&lt;span style="font-size:85%;"&gt;* SOA in Dutch stands for Seksueel Overdraagbare Aandoeningen, which means Sexually Transmitted Diseases ...&lt;/span&gt;&lt;br /&gt;&lt;/em&gt;&lt;br /&gt;&lt;br /&gt;&lt;/p&gt;&lt;span style="font-size:85%;"&gt;&lt;/span&gt;&lt;div class="blogger-post-footer"&gt;&lt;img width='1' height='1' src='https://blogger.googleusercontent.com/tracker/19717775-113425724642295282?l=mkyap.blogspot.com' alt='' /&gt;&lt;/div&gt;</content><link rel='replies' type='application/atom+xml' href='http://mkyap.blogspot.com/feeds/113425724642295282/comments/default' title='Post Comments'/><link rel='replies' type='text/html' href='http://www.blogger.com/comment.g?blogID=19717775&amp;postID=113425724642295282' title='3 Comments'/><link rel='edit' type='application/atom+xml' href='http://www.blogger.com/feeds/19717775/posts/default/113425724642295282'/><link rel='self' type='application/atom+xml' href='http://www.blogger.com/feeds/19717775/posts/default/113425724642295282'/><link rel='alternate' type='text/html' href='http://mkyap.blogspot.com/2005/12/designing-and-developing-soa-based.html' title='Designing and Developing SOA based application'/><author><name>Manh-Kiet Yap</name><uri>http://www.blogger.com/profile/06593472507265724096</uri><email>noreply@blogger.com</email><gd:image rel='http://schemas.google.com/g/2005#thumbnail' width='24' height='32' src='http://photos1.blogger.com/hello/117/9006/320/ky_portrait.jpg'/></author><thr:total>3</thr:total></entry><entry><id>tag:blogger.com,1999:blog-19717775.post-113416898095568660</id><published>2005-12-09T23:55:00.000-08:00</published><updated>2005-12-12T15:41:06.763-08:00</updated><title type='text'>My First Post</title><content type='html'>&lt;span style="font-size:85%;"&gt;Hurrah ! After multiple attempts - and a lot of hesitations as well, I finally create my blog.&lt;br /&gt;I'll try to keep it up to date with my latest finding around Service Oriented Architecture and Identity Management. I hope you will appreciate it and please feel free to send me your comments to improve the quality of this blog !&lt;/span&gt;&lt;div class="blogger-post-footer"&gt;&lt;img width='1' height='1' src='https://blogger.googleusercontent.com/tracker/19717775-113416898095568660?l=mkyap.blogspot.com' alt='' /&gt;&lt;/div&gt;</content><link rel='replies' type='application/atom+xml' href='http://mkyap.blogspot.com/feeds/113416898095568660/comments/default' title='Post Comments'/><link rel='replies' type='text/html' href='http://www.blogger.com/comment.g?blogID=19717775&amp;postID=113416898095568660' title='0 Comments'/><link rel='edit' type='application/atom+xml' href='http://www.blogger.com/feeds/19717775/posts/default/113416898095568660'/><link rel='self' type='application/atom+xml' href='http://www.blogger.com/feeds/19717775/posts/default/113416898095568660'/><link rel='alternate' type='text/html' href='http://mkyap.blogspot.com/2005/12/my-first-post.html' title='My First Post'/><author><name>Manh-Kiet Yap</name><uri>http://www.blogger.com/profile/06593472507265724096</uri><email>noreply@blogger.com</email><gd:image rel='http://schemas.google.com/g/2005#thumbnail' width='24' height='32' src='http://photos1.blogger.com/hello/117/9006/320/ky_portrait.jpg'/></author><thr:total>0</thr:total></entry></feed>
